CHP steps up holiday enforcement

The California Highway Patrol is working to keep the roads safe from drunk drivers in Santa Barbara County on New Year's Day.

Officers will be conducting a DUI checkpoint in an unincorporated area of Santa Barbara County from 8:00pm Friday to 2:00 am Saturday. Motorists will only be stopped for a few moments.

"If you're going to have a few drinks, do not drive. Plan ahead. Have a designated driver. Call a cab, anything but get behind the wheel. Otherwise, expect to suffer the consequences, said CHP Officer Rob Wallace in Santa Maria.

Those consequences include jail time. Last year, the CHP reported two DUI related accidents. One was fatal. Officers also remind drivers to *always wear their seatbelts.
